who does benedict bridgerton end up with
Benedict Bridgerton ultimately ends up with Sophie Beckett, the mysterious masked woman from the masquerade ball, in the original Bridgerton book storyline.
Quick Scoop: Books vs. Show
- In Julia Quinnâs novels, Benedictâs love story is told in An Offer From a Gentleman , a Cinderella-style romance centered on Sophie Beckett.
- Sheâs the masked woman he falls for at a ball, and after a long, angsty journey involving class differences and her position as a servant, they do end up together and marry by the end of the book.
Whatâs Happening in the Netflix Series Right Now
- As of Bridgerton Season 4 Part 1 (released early 2026), Benedict and Sophieâs relationship is still in turmoil on screen.
- The season ends (so far) with Benedict making the controversial offer that Sophie become his mistress rather than his wife, which deeply offends her and leaves their future unresolved.
- So: in the books , he very clearly ends up with Sophie; in the show , Part 1 leaves them at a breaking point, but the arc is still clearly tracking toward a Sophie endgame, just with a messier, more modern-feeling route.
